Trace Finance Secures $32M to Bridge Stablecoins and Global Banking

Trace Finance has successfully closed a $32 million funding round aimed at scaling its cross-border stablecoin settlement infrastructure.

Trace Finance, a firm focused on streamlining international payments, has locked in $32 million in new capital. The fresh injection of funds is earmarked for expanding the company’s ability to bridge the gap between blockchain-based stablecoins and legacy banking rails.

The move arrives at a critical juncture for the digital asset industry. As regulatory frameworks for stablecoins mature on a global scale, institutional interest in integrating decentralized payment channels with traditional financial systems has reached a fever pitch.

By facilitating faster, more efficient cross-border settlements, the company aims to reduce the friction typically associated with international wire transfers. This infrastructure push represents a broader trend of major players betting on the long-term viability of stablecoins in mainstream commerce.

Key growth objectives include:

  • Enhanced interoperability with traditional banking networks.
  • Expanded infrastructure for high-volume cross-border transactions.
  • Compliance-focused scaling in line with emerging global standards.
